#f732c9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f732c9 is composed of 96.9% red, 19.6%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.8% magenta, 18.6%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 314 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 58.2%. #f732c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64ff with #ef0093.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#f732c9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f732c9 has RGB values of R:247, G:50,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.19,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16200393.

Hex triplet f732c9 #f732c9
RGB Decimal 247, 50, 201 rgb(247,50,201)
RGB Percent 96.9, 19.6, 78.8 rgb(96.9%,19.6%,78.8%)
CMYK 0, 80, 19, 3
HSL 314°, 92.5, 58.2 hsl(314,92.5%,58.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 314°, 79.8, 96.9
Web Safe ff33cc #ff33cc
CIE-LAB 58.299, 83.485, -33.737
XYZ 50.041, 26.277, 57.692
xyY 0.373, 0.196, 26.277
CIE-LCH 58.299, 90.044, 337.996
CIE-LUV 58.299, 95.824, -64.58
Hunter-Lab 51.261, 84.546, -30.846
Binary 11110111, 00110010, 11001001

Shades and Tints of #f732c9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#feeffb is the lightest one.
